我有一种处理方法,它使用pandas.DataFrame.to_csv()创建数据的.csv文件,并且我希望执行几次这种处理,每次将新数据追加到已经存在的文件中。 (每种处理的输出列名称都相同)
当然,解决我的问题的一种方法是为每种处理方法创建一个文件,然后将它们串联起来,但是我想这样做而无需对脚本进行太多更改。
是否可以在熊猫0.14中附加到现有的.csv文件? (很遗憾,我无法升级我的版本)。 我当时以为我可以使用'mode'参数http://pandas.pydata.org/pandas-docs/version/0.14.0/generated/pandas.DataFrame.to_csv.html?highlight=to_csv#pandas.DataFrame.to_csv来做某事,但是我似乎找不到合适的方法。
有什么建议吗?
答案 0 :(得分:1)
是的,您可以使用写入模式size_type
。您可能还需要/想要使用'a'
。
我不清楚您为什么不想将header=False
放入.read_csv()
放入df.append()
,但这似乎也是一个选择